Why not keep the JBL amp and put the money for the new amp into the speakers, you will here more of a difference with a better set of speakers than just changing that amp out. Then as your budget upgrade your amp.

The amp story sounds like a sales pitch. As for the speakers the best thing you can do is  just go audition some speakers. Just look for a efficient speakers that have a higher db rating. Example 98db rating should be louder than the 86 db speaker at the same power input. But then again every manufacture uses different methods of producing there rating.
